### Escalation — Sweepster Orphan Cleanup

If Sweepster flags more than 500 orphaned volumes in one pass, don't panic — it's usually a stale tag filter, not an actual leak. Pause the sweep with `sweepster halt`, snapshot the candidate list, and ping the infra channel. If the list includes anything tagged `release-locked`, that's a hard stop: nothing gets deleted until the Calderon Cloud platform leads sign off. For sign-off requests or anything you can't untangle within an hour, email the sweeper owners.

alerts address for kafog-haweg: wendor.ulaael@zemvarworks.internal

The GraphLattice visualizer renders dependency graphs for every service registered in the Mosswell build system. When you request a graph, the service walks the manifest tree, resolves transitive edges, and returns a layout document you can render client-side. New team members should start with read-only queries against the staging index before touching production manifests. All requests to the GraphLattice endpoint must be authenticated with the internal service key, which is provided below for the staging environment.

app token of kaduf-hagug = vxb4-Q0rH

## Blue-Green Deploys: Tallygrove Billing Worker

Quick refresher for support: the billing worker runs two identical stacks, blue and green. We flip traffic only after the idle side passes invoice replay checks, so a bad deploy never touches live charges. If a customer asks what version processed their invoice, check the swap log first. The currently-live build is stamped right here for reference.

session token of kageg-tahop = htk14_af3c1ccccb7dcf